Navigating Institutional Constraints in the Process of Computational Environmental Modeling

Abstract The use of computational models has proliferated in the last few decades due to the practical benefits that they offer in terms of understanding complex systems. However, the process of developing a computational model is not only shaped by scientific and practical concerns. Modelers must also navigate the institutional structures in which the models are constructed and implemented. In the process, they must often draw upon existing or create new social relationships that can, themselves, alter the institutional structures they are attempting to navigate. In this article, I use an ethnographic approach to examine three examples in which the process of building and implementing a computational model was constrained by institutional factors and the strategies the modelers used to navigate them. The research was conducted with computational modelers at the Chesapeake Bay Program who are involved in constructing the Chesapeake Bay modeling system for nutrient management in the watershed. Modelers in this context had to: build relationships with the broader scientific community to reinforce the “believability” of the model, draw upon institutional relationships in order to work around limitations on data-sharing between organizations, and manage differing incentive structures to motivate and coordinate the research needed to complete the model

在计算环境建模过程中导航制度约束

摘要 由于计算模型在理解复杂系统方面提供的实际好处,计算模型的使用在过去几十年中激增。然而,开发计算模型的过程不仅受科学和实际问题的影响。建模者还必须在构建和实施模型的制度结构中导航。在这个过程中,他们必须经常利用现有的或创造新的社会关系,这些关系本身可以改变他们试图驾驭的制度结构。在本文中,我使用人种学方法来检查三个示例,其中构建和实施计算模型的过程受到制度因素和建模者用来导航它们的策略的约束。该研究由切萨皮克湾计划的计算建模人员进行,他们参与了为流域营养管理构建切萨皮克湾建模系统。在这种情况下,建模者必须:与更广泛的科学界建立关系以增强模型的“可信度”,利用制度关系来解决组织之间数据共享的限制,并管理不同的激励结构以激励和协调完成模型所需的研究
